What hospice modifier does Medicare use?
Hospice Modifier GV This is true regardless whether the care is related to the patient's terminal illness. HCPCS modifier GV signifies that: The service was rendered to a patient enrolled in a hospice. -
What modifier to use for Medicare hospice?
When a patient is under hospice, there is a certain diagnosis that was indicated at the beginning of care. If the service the physician renders is unrelated to the terminal illnesses that hospice has on record, Medicare will not reimburse for the service unless it is submitted with the modifier GW. -
What is the modifier for hospice billing?
GW Modifier This modifier should be used when a service is rendered to a patient enrolled in a hospice and the service is unrelated to the patient's terminal condition. All providers must submit this modifier when: The service(s) provided are unrelated to the patient's terminal condition. -

How do you bill Medicare when patient is in hospice?
Physician Service Categories Once a Medicare patient elects hospice, care related to the terminal diagnosis is paid directly by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) to the hospice provider. Physician services are billed by the hospice ing to the nature of the service performed.
